Mushroom Spinach White Pizza

  • Total Time: 27 minutes
  • Yield: Two 10-inch pizzas 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

A creamy and delicious white pizza topped with ricotta, mozzarella, mushrooms, and fresh spinach. Perfect for a homemade pizza night!


Ingredients

Scale

For the Dough:

  • 1.5 lb pizza dough (store-bought or homemade)

For the Cheese Mixture:

  • 1 cup ricotta cheese
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• ½ teaspoon dried basil

For the Toppings:

  • 1 package button mushrooms, sliced
  • 23 cups baby spinach leaves
  • ⅔ cup shredded mozzarella cheese

For Cooking & Seasoning:

  • 1 teaspoon butter
  • ¼ teaspoon dried thyme
  • 1 teaspoon olive oil
  • ½ teaspoon garlic powder
  • Freshly ground black pepper
  • ½ teaspoon red pepper flakes (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at the Oven to 450°F.
  2. Cook the Mushrooms: Sauté in a skillet over high heat. Once browned, add butter and thyme. Remove and set aside.
  3. Wilt the Spinach: Cook with olive oil, garlic powder, and salt until wilted. Set aside.
  4. Prepare the Ricotta Mixture: Mix ricotta, salt, Italian seasoning, and basil in a bowl.
  5. Roll Out the Dough: Divide into two portions and stretch into thin rounds.
  6. Assemble the Pizza:
    • Spread the ricotta mixture over the dough.
    • Add the cooked mushrooms and spinach.
    • Sprinkle mozzarella cheese on top.
    • Add red pepper flakes and black pepper.
  7. Bake for 11-12 minutes until golden and crispy.
  8. Slice and Serve Immediately.

Notes

  • Red pepper flakes are optional for a spicy kick.
  • Adding dollops of ricotta before baking creates a creamier texture.
  • A sprinkle of Parmesan or a drizzle of olive oil after baking enhances the flavor.
